Abstract

A method of managing charging of a traction battery and corresponding devices, the traction battery including a thermal regulating system, the thermal regulating system including a compressor, the method including transmitting information between a control device for the compressor and a device for managing the charging of the traction battery, before activating the compressor or before activating a device for charging the traction battery.

Claims (31)

1. A method of managing charging of a traction battery of a vehicle having a heat regulating system including a compressor, the method comprising:

monitoring, via a control device of the compressor, a status of the compressor;

transmitting, via the control device, information of the status of the compressor, before activating the compressor or before activating charging of the traction battery, between the control device and a charging management device for managing charging of the traction battery; or

transmitting, via the charging management device, information of a charging status, before activating the compressor or before activating charging of the traction battery, between the charging management device and the control device; and

controlling, based on the transmitted information, at least one of the compressor and the charging of the traction battery.

2.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ising:

providing electrical isolation between the compressor and an external supply network configured to charge the traction battery when the information is representative of an imminent activation of the compressor.

3. The method of managing charging as claim in claim 1 , further comprising:

interrupting or postponing the charging of the traction battery for at least a first predetermined duration when information is representative of an imminent activation of the compressor.

4.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the first predetermined duration is a function of at least one of an external temperature and current speed of the compressor.

5.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the first predetermined duration is incremented by a duration required by a motor of the compressor to reach a predetermined minimum speed which is a function of an external temperature.

6.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, wherein, when the compressor requires plural activations to meet a requirement of the heat regulating system, the charging of the traction battery is uninterrupted after a predetermined number of activations of the compressor.

7.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the control device of the compressor sets a minimum speed at a motor of the compressor, the minimum speed being a function of an external temperature.

8.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, further comprising:

delaying, after transmitting the information, the activation of the compressor for a second predetermined duration which is shorter than the first predetermined duration, and

transmitting information representative of an advanced state of activation of the compressor at an end of the first predetermined duration.

9.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the transmitting information is preceded by an interrogation about a state of the compressor by the charging management device, and the first predetermined duration is supervised by the charging management device.

10. The method of managing charging as claimed in claim 2 , further comprising:

disabling the compressor after the electrical isolation and until an end of charging the traction battery.
